Expecting too much can make you miserable and be detrimental to you functioning. Here’s why and what you can do about it. Let’s start with the word itself – expect. To expect connotes a sense of certainty about what will occur in the future. From the price of stocks and homes to the occurrence of hurricanes, from repairmen showing up on time to our children cleaning up their rooms when we ask them – is there anything about which we can really be certain? Mid-life crisis: Seen the movie?
March 14th, 2012Although may take middle age in stride, experiencing a mid-life crisis is fairly common among both women and men. For some, the problem is existential: acknowledging that life h as reached the midpoint can engender complex self-questioning about the meaning of life and whether one’s true purpose has been fulfilled. Other may find the physical changes associated with getting older more daunting then the philosophical issues. Whether the trigger is graying hair, an expanding waistline, career dissatisfaction or relationship ennui, a mid-life crisis can be hard to deal with.
